## Sale of the Windmere Analytics Unit

Restricted: managers only.

Garrondale plc has agreed in principle to sell Windmere Analytics to Velspar Group. The incoming director should note that due diligence closes at month-end, and all staffing decisions are frozen until then. Client contracts transfer intact. Announcements remain embargoed pending board sign-off. The confidential note on forward plans follows below.

management briefing: Project Ulavan slips by two quarters because of the staffing delay.

Fan-out backpressure for the Quillet notifier: when the queue depth crosses the soft limit, the dispatcher sheds low-priority pushes and batches the rest at 500ms intervals. Reviewer should confirm the shed counter is exported and that retries respect the jitter window. Once merged, the release artifact gets re-signed by the pipeline, which expects the deploy key shown below.

deploy key for bawep-yawif: bky6_GQhaSt

### Runbook: Snapcellar image-cache leak

Reviewer notes: the leak stems from cache entries pinned by the preview renderer. The fix adds a TTL enforcer that requires an authenticated flush endpoint. Confirm the enforcer interval is under 60s and that flush calls are rate-limited. The flush endpoint's credential is set on the line below.

sealed setting: VAULT_KEY20=c8ea1e419912889df6b4

Runbook: AgriPulse telemetry gateway (Harrowfield cluster). When combine units stop reporting, first confirm the MQTT bridge is accepting connections, then check the ingest queue depth on the Fennick dashboard. If the bridge restarts, it reloads credentials from the gateway env file. Before restarting, verify the file contains the broker credential entry; the broker access key is set on the next line.

vault entry, yahif-yajep: COURIER_KEY29=b802bdf8034096b65a51c6ba5abe2